Tropical Romantic S. Kona Cottage with Incredible Oceanview
Makalani (Heavenly View) Cottage is a delightfully romantic cottage surrounded by a tropical garden in South Kona's coffee-belt with a breathtaking panoramic view of the Pacific Ocean. For the adventurous traveler seeking authentic Hawaiian beauty and serenity, you can spend your whole vacation here gazing out over the endless ocean and its incredible sunsets. In the winter, you can spot whales breaching from your outdoor lanai or listen to them singing at night. Awaken to the music of colorful birdsong from papaya, mango and banana trees.
With a perfect year-round climate, perched at 1200 ft. above the sea on the side of Mauna Loa Volcano, Makalani Oceanview Cottage is authentic Hawai'i unspoiled by crowds and resorts. A great location that gives you many options for experiencing The Big Island's natural diversity. From your cottage you are just 4-minutes from the closest beach and 15-minutes to Ho'okena Beach State Park for sunbathing and swimming with dolphins. A 20-minute drive brings you to the famous Pu'uhonua o'Honaunau (Place of Refuge) National Historic Park and Kealakekua Bay where you can kayak to Captain Cook's monument and snorkel with an endless variety of tropical fish and sea turtles. And best of all, you're only 65-minutes from Madame Pele's live action at Volcanos National Park.
Your cottage is tastefully appointed with Indonesian teak furniture providing a romantic comfort reminiscent of Colonial British tropics. Your large open-room (studio) cottage sleeps two luxuriously with a romantic king-size canopy-bed with a memory-foam mattress fit for royalty. There is also a convertible couch-futon which can comfortably sleep two additional guests. You'll have a fully-equipped kitchen as well as dining area for four. A large outdoor lanai with barbeque gives you garden seating with a stunning ocean view. Your detached private bathroom with semi- outdoor shower will provide a refreshing Hawaiian experience with nature.
There is also a detached guestroom/meditation room available which is set in a grove of mango trees overlooking the ocean, called the 'Mango Grove Lookout'. It has a sofa-futon which can comfortably sleep one or two people. Serene and magical, this special extra-room provides daytime privacy as well as an intimate camp-like Hawaiian sleeping experience.
Managed with aloha spirit, Makalani Oceanview Cottage is the perfect vacation/retreat cottage where you'll find yourself surrounded by the natural beauty of Hawaii. We hope your stay here will be the first of many happy vacations to South Kona and this beautiful island of Hawaii.

About the neighborhood
Captain Cook
Located in Opihihale, a neighborhood in Captain Cook, this cottage is in a rural area and by the sea.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Manuka State Park and Pebbles Beach, while Kona Coffee Living History Farm and H.N. Greenwell Store Museum are cultural highlights. Bay View Farm and Big Island Bees are also worth visiting. Kayaking and scuba diving off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with cave exploring and mountain climbing nearby.
